Transaction 80865562a6651863acf5e9f659e2505b9347e067497c9042335343bc01ed4748
1 Input
1 Output
-
80865562a6651863acf5e9f659e2505b9347e067497c9042335343bc01ed4748:0
- value
- 698600000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c263471bbea16bc3e746a34889215cdefe369579 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Jiq2A1PesaNVWjVNjyaLKGgoGFfqgZDtE